# Client setup for the Norwhistle partner SFTP drop.
# Quick context for review: partner files land in the drop
# bucket every night around 02:00, and this client pulls them
# into the Larkspur ingest queue. We never write back to the
# partner side — read-only by design, enforced at the gateway.
# Retries are capped at three to avoid hammering their box.
# The ingest gateway authenticates with the internal key below.

gateway credential: kto23_LX9A4ys6i4nzHtpOLNLodKK

Postmortem timeline — PickPath optimizer outage, Harlow DC. 09:12 optimizer began emitting empty pick lists after zone map refresh. 09:20 pickers fell back to manual routing; throughput dropped ~40%. 09:34 rollback initiated to prior model bundle. 09:41 lists resumed; backlog cleared by 10:15. Root cause: zone refresh job shipped a schema the scorer couldn't parse, and validation was skipped on the fast path. Fix: hard-fail on schema mismatch; add canary zone. The rollback was verified against the trace recorded below.

trace token, fafog-kageg: htk4_98e6

# Dedupe Limits & Quotas

Our alert deduplicator, Quenchling, keeps things sane during pager storms, but it has hard ceilings. Past the per-service quota, alerts get bucketed into a single rollup — annoying but intentional. If a team keeps hitting the cap, fix the noisy source rather than raising limits. Bump these only with sign-off from the on-call guild. The current knobs are listed below.

tuning constants:
RATE_LIMITS = {
    "wenwyn": 1,
    "zorix": 10,
    "oliix": 2,
    "holael": 10,
}

FAQ: How do I schedule batch email digests from my plugin?

Use the DigestHook API. Register a cadence (hourly, daily, weekly) at install time; Mailgrove coalesces entries per recipient and sends at the tenant's configured window. You cannot set exact send times — the scheduler owns that. Payload limit is 200 entries per digest; overflow rolls to the next window. Rate limits apply per plugin, not per tenant. Scheduling rules and payload schemas are documented on the page below.

runbook for badug-kadup: https://confluence.zemvarlabs.internal/projects/browse/display/projects/bd1b